Experience the serene beauty of Winslow Homer's 'Morning Glories'! This Luminist masterpiece captures a tranquil garden scene with delicate light and vibrant colors, reflecting Victorian sensibilities & artistic innovation.
A captivating portrait of a woman in white, adorned with a black belt and clutching a book – Winslow Homer’s masterful depiction captures the essence of Victorian elegance against a backdrop of serene outdoor scenery.
The Red School House by Winslow Homer – National Gallery of Art explores the poignant narrative of a young teacher amidst a serene mountain landscape, capturing the essence of American Realism and reflecting nostalgia for rural education during the Victorian era.
